Battery

The most straightforward way to repair the battery of your key fob is to replace it. The fob uses a small coin-shaped 3V battery (CR2032 or CR2025) that is usually easily found in general stores, home improvement shops, and a few auto parts stores. Use a brand new battery. Old batteries can cause damage to the circuit boards and cease to be useful.

Start by opening the fob. It may be a bit tight, but with the help of a flat screwdriver, you should be able separate the halves. After that, slide the screwdriver into the edges of the fob and lift the clips to secure it. They are easily broken so proceed slowly and with care.

Reassemble the fob after replacing the battery, and test to see if it is working as it should. If it still doesn't work try pressing the button a few times and verifying whether the contacts are clean. You could also try the issue with a spare fob to see if the problem is not specific to the key. If it isn't it could be another reason that the key fob isn't working. For instance it could be because the button is worn out. Its primary function is to permit your car to recognize the key fob and open its doors as you approach it and start when you press the ignition button.

The problem is, interference can sometimes hinder this communication. For example, if you have your second-generation Apple Pencil charged while you're holding the fob, it could stop you from unlocking your car (via iGeneration).

Other electronic devices that operate on the same frequency as the fob might interfere with the signal. This includes garage door openers as well as tire-pressure monitoring systems. Even a transmitter at your home could be causing interference, but this is difficult for a professional to test.

It's possible that your fob is simply reprogrammed. The transmitter inside your key fob must be recognized by Mini's receiver. A unique code is then created for each pairing. The fob needs to be programmed when they are removed from the system or replaced, either after you purchase a replacement and in some cases when the battery is replaced. To reprogram a fob follow the directions in the owner's guideline or ask a dealer for assistance.
